// MAX_LAYER_COUNT governs the image-slimming pass in the Ovenbird
// packaging pipeline. Do not raise this without checking with the
// platform team: the Tidewell registry rejects images above this
// layer count, and the slimming pass silently skips oversized
// images rather than failing the build. If you change this value,
// rebuild the base image and confirm the pipeline stamped the new
// artifact correctly. The reference build token is recorded below.

trace token, fafog-kageg: htk4_98e6

- [ ] **Step 7: Breaker override escrow.** After sealing the signing keys for the Tallgrove upstream API circuit breaker, confirm the support team can force the breaker open during a full outage. The override bundle lives in the sealed escrow drawer and is useless without its unlock phrase. Two ceremony witnesses must initial this step before proceeding. The escrow bundle is decrypted with the recovery passphrase that follows.

vault phrase of kahip-kahop = holath-quenmir

Fan-out backpressure for the Quillet notifier: when the queue depth crosses the soft limit, the dispatcher sheds low-priority pushes and batches the rest at 500ms intervals. Reviewer should confirm the shed counter is exported and that retries respect the jitter window. Once merged, the release artifact gets re-signed by the pipeline, which expects the deploy key shown below.

deploy key for bawep-yawif: bky6_GQhaSt

**Ticket: Seat-map renderer failing in plugin sandbox**

External plugins for the Gildencourt Theatre seat-map renderer are getting blank canvases in the sandbox environment. Cause: the sandbox env file points `SEATMAP_TILE_SOURCE` at the decommissioned Norrel tile host, so geometry never loads. Update it to the current host and clear the tile cache before retesting. The renderer also authenticates to the tile host on boot, and that credential belongs on the next line.

sealed setting: RELAY_SECRET5=82864